    FW transfer is no different than whats on the tape. It is simply copiying the information from th etape. It is not doing anything to the quality of the footage so there are only 3 possiblities.
    1) The computer monitor you’re looking at th efootage on sucks and it looks worse than it actually is
    2) there is a problem in your FW connection somewhere
    or 3) you aren’t really decribing the problem quite as well as you can (no offense please but its hard to solve a problem without all of the information up front)
    Now to try to solve it.
    If its 1 then beg or borrow another monitor and check it out (I’ve had it happen where one monitor looked a lot worse than another)
    If its 2) then pick up another FW card and Cable -they’re both inexpensive – and change ONE at a time and see what happens. I don’t think its 3 anymore as you’ve now given us the information to try to help you solve this. Again remember t ocheck the preview settings on the Vegas Preview-Draft qaulity doesn’t look so good.

    [Pieper1] “i guess just to sum all that up…why cant i get the same quality on my computer that i get on my dvd recorder?”

    And the short answer is – you CAN. As we’ve said, capturing via firewire using VidCap will give you an EXACT copy of what’s on the tape. If you’re not seeing full quality then something else is going on. As an alternative, you may try capturing with Scenalyzer Live and see how that looks.
